Pengenalan dan Video Cara Install Aplikasi dan Animasi 2D: Bridge Coding Logic With Artistic Animation Workflows

Understanding the Core Principles of Modern Web Development

Novices navigating backend programming ecosystems, Laravel distinguishes itself through a flexible solution to develop dynamic projects. Its developer-friendly architecture facilitates complex tasks including database migrations, without compromising clarity for collaborators. Belajar Laravel Untuk Pemula serves as a vital groundwork for mastering this framework, through numerous open-access guides demystifying initial setup phases.

Enhancing coding expertise, the integration between technical proficiency paired with visual storytelling now represents a signature element of contemporary digital projects. This interplay allows coders to craft immersive interfaces that merge purpose with visual polish.

Configuring Your Development Environment Efficiently

Prior to running starter web solutions, correct system configuration stands as non-negotiable. Initiate the process by picking a local server stack such as MAMP to emulate live server environments. PHP version compatibility requires confirmation to avoid dependency conflicts during component integrations.

CLI applications like Composer execute vital operations for handling Laravel's dependencies. Run setup directives meticulously, cross-referencing Laravel's resources to diagnose permission errors that commonly arise in multi-user environments. Those preferring graphical interfaces, Pengenalan dan Video Cara Install Aplikasi dan animasi 2D assets deliver step-by-step visual guides detailing technical preparation requirements.

Implementing Basic Routing and Controller Logic

Endpoint management protocols serve as the core of any Laravel application. Through concise script excerpts, developers can define client-side petitions get handled across different system components. Start by creating a sample endpoint within the central pathway configuration, linking it to a temporary logic block which outputs simple web elements.

As complexity grows, shifting to organized modules proves necessary to preserve clean code architecture. Create a primary command center via Laravel's built-in CLI creation tool, then bind it with particular URLs via the Route::get() method. This division of concerns enhances long-term scalability while enabling multi-programmer workflows without code overlap issues.

Mastering Database Migrations and Eloquent ORM Integration

Streamlined database orchestration lies at the heart for interactive digital solutions. The framework’s schema builder revolutionizes repetitive query writing into version-controlled scripts, allowing coders to modify data architectures free from manual server access. Generate a schema template using Artisan’s terminal-based utility, outlining fields such as VARCHAR strings alongside unsigned integers with fluent methods.

The active record implementation enhances data interactions through conceptualizing tables as classes. Draft an Eloquent class linked to a designated schema, before employing methods like get() to retrieve entries without writing raw SQL. Relationships such as belongsTo() mirror real-world data dependencies, simplifying cross-dataset queries via maintainable logic.

Designing Dynamic Interfaces With Blade Templating Engine

Laravel’s Blade templating empowers developers to craft reusable UI elements blending PHP logic alongside HTML/CSS structures. Diverging from rudimentary print statements, its clean syntax facilitate inheritance workflows via @foreach commands, eradicating cluttered code. Convert basic layouts into dynamic templates by injecting data points from backend handlers.

Template inheritance curtails repetition by letting secondary templates acquire base designs yet customize targeted blocks including headers and CTAs. Reusable element design takes this further with @include directives which piece together dashboards from prebuilt snippets. For animations, link dynamic views alongside CSS transitions for creating interactive buttons absent undermining server efficiency.

Integrating 2D Animation Techniques Into Web Applications

Modern web experiences necessitate a balance between utility plus creative expression. Vector-based effects function as effective instruments to direct audience focus via smooth transformations, elevating navigational clarity. Implement JavaScript animations into frontend templates to activate buttons based on click events. Focus on resource efficiency through selecting hardware-accelerated properties over resource-heavy GIFs.

In scenarios requiring advanced choreography, libraries like Three.js provide granular keyframing capable of coordinating various components throughout gamified experiences. Embed more info these resources through Webpack configurations to streamline version control during compilation phases. Test animations using browsers to ensure reliable playback minus content jumps.

Implementing Robust Authentication and Authorization Systems

User security remains a priority for applications handling sensitive information. The framework’s native authentication scaffolding accelerate feature implementation using ready-made security layers managing sign-up workflows, user sessions, alongside security protocols. Customize base templates to match design guidelines without altering underlying validation rules.

Permission management extend security through specifying specific tasks users can perform within the application. Generate rule sets through terminal utilities to centralize operational requirements, and link them to database entries to enable automatic permission checks. Route guards like auth introduce tiers of verification, limiting unauthenticated requests to private routes.

Deploying Applications and Optimizing Performance at Scale

Publishing the developed solution demands methodical execution to ensure consistent availability amidst traffic spikes. Select a cloud platform that matches to resource needs, prioritizing scalable infrastructure. Configure environment variables to match testing environments, updating APP_KEY settings for live-appropriate states.

Speed optimization requires storing repetitive database queries using Memcached, optimizing static resources, alongside enabling Gzip compression. Observe system performance with tools like Laravel Telescope to pinpoint bottlenecks, then iterate logic to achieve sub-second loading. Adopt auto-scaling methods when traffic grow, splitting processes among multiple servers guaranteeing enterprise-grade resilience.

Leave a Reply

Your email address will not be published. Required fields are marked *